This is a design from Tokuriki’s lovely “Thirty Views of Kyoto” series, published by Uchida in 1936. The print is rendered in a painterly style with subdued colors and soft shading. First edition images from this series are rarely seen on the market. Shimogamo Shrine (Shimogamo-jinja in Japanese), is the common name of an important Shinto sanctuary in the Shimogamo district of Kyoto city’s Sakyō ward. It is one of the oldest Shinto shrines in Japan and is one of the seventeen Historic Monuments of Ancient Kyoto which have been designated by UNESCO as a World Heritage Site. Shimogamo dates to the 6th century, centuries before Kyoto became the capital of Japan.
This first edition print has excellent color and detail. The print is mounted to stiff board in the nearly square shikishiban format, ready for display, with a label on the reverse.
